
Self-driving cars and space robots: This professor draws national eyes to Illinois Tech
Self-driving cars. Space robots. These are the realm of Matthew Spenko, head of the Robotics Lab at the Illinois Institute of Technology. Illinois Tech ranks No. 78 among graduate engineering...


